Discover Jodhpur: A 4-Day Adventure in the Blue City

Saturday August 12: Exploring the Majestic Mehrangarh Fort

Start your Jodhpur adventure by visiting the iconic Mehrangarh Fort in the morning. This magnificent fort, perched on a hilltop, offers breathtaking views of the city. Explore the various palaces and museums within the fort complex, immersing yourself in the rich history and culture of Rajasthan. In the afternoon, head to Jaswant Thada, a beautiful marble cenotaph located near the fort. As the evening sets in, wander through the vibrant Sardar Market, where you can shop for handicrafts, textiles, and spices.

  • Mehrangarh Fort: Estimated Cost - INR 600 (foreigners), INR 100 (Indians), Estimated Time Spent - 3-4 hours
  • Jaswant Thada: Estimated Cost - INR 30 (foreigners), INR 15 (Indians), Estimated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Sardar Market: Cost varies (shopping), Estimated Time Spent - 2-3 hours
Sunday August 13: Marveling at Umaid Bhawan Palace

On day two, start your morning with a visit to Umaid Bhawan Palace, a splendid architectural masterpiece. Explore the palace museum, showcasing artifacts and exhibits that offer insights into the royal heritage of Jodhpur. In the afternoon, take a relaxing stroll through Mandore Gardens, known for its beautifully landscaped lawns, temples, and cenotaphs. As the evening approaches, enjoy a traditional Rajasthani dinner at one of the local restaurants in the city.

  • Umaid Bhawan Palace: Estimated Cost - INR 30 (foreigners), INR 15 (Indians), Estimated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Mandore Gardens: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Traditional Rajasthani Dinner: Cost varies (dining), Estimated Time Spent - 2-3 hours
Monday August 14: Exploring the Old City and Markets

Embark on a journey through the narrow lanes of Jodhpur's old city, also known as the Blue City, in the morning. Discover the vibrant blue-painted houses and intricately carved havelis, taking in the unique charm of the area. Visit the Clock Tower and explore the bustling Sardar Market, where you can find a wide array of textiles, handicrafts, and spices. In the afternoon, visit the beautiful Toorji Ka Jhalra, a stepwell that offers a refreshing respite from the city heat. End your day with a visit to the bustling and aromatic Sojati Gate Market.

  • Old City (Blue City):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 3-4 hours
  • Sardar Market: Cost varies (shopping), Estimated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Toorji Ka Jhalra: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Sojati Gate Market: Cost varies (shopping), Estimated Time Spent - 1-2 hours
Tuesday August 15: Day Trip to the Bishnoi Villages

On your final day in Jodhpur, embark on a day trip to the scenic Bishnoi Villages. Immerse yourself in the rural beauty of Rajasthan as you interact with the local Bishnoi community known for their conservation efforts and unique way of life. Witness traditional handicraft demonstrations, spot wildlife in the nearby Khejarli village, and learn about the region's rich cultural heritage. In the afternoon, savor a picnic lunch amidst the serene surroundings. Return to Jodhpur in the evening and enjoy a leisurely walk along the picturesque Rao Jodha Desert Rock Park.

  • Bishnoi Villages Day Trip: Estimated Cost - INR 1500-2000 (including transportation and lunch), Estimated Time Spent - 6-8 hours
  • Rao Jodha Desert Rock Park: Estimated Cost - INR 100 (foreigners), INR 50 (Indians), Estimated Time Spent - 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Jodhpur, don't miss out on visiting the lesser-known attractions and experiencing the local favorites. Take a detour to visit the beautiful Mandaleshwar Mahadev Temple, situated on a hilltop and offering panoramic views of the city. Indulge in the flavors of Jodhpur by trying the famous local delicacies like Makhaniya Lassi and Pyaaz Kachori. For a unique experience, consider attending a traditional Rajasthani music and dance performance in one of the cultural centers or havelis.
